Cynar is a UK company established to commercialize the ThermoFuel technology exclusively licensed to it in the UK and Ireland by its owners, Ozmotech Pty Ltd. The waste plastics to hydrocarbon fuels liquefaction technology is based on pyrolysis and distillation. Cynar’s first plant is built and operating in Portlaoise, Ireland.

DIBANET is coordinated by the Carbolea Research Group at the University of Limerick in Ireland. DIBANET focuses on the conversion, by non-biological means, of the lignocellulosic biomass residues and wastes of Europe and Latin America to platform chemicals, such as levulinic acid and furfural, and biofuels.
